Asking insightful questions demonstrates your interest in the role from "summary" of Interviewing Like a Boss by Dominic Cleveland

When you ask insightful questions during an interview, you are not just showing that you are prepared - you are also demonstrating your genuine interest in the role. By asking thoughtful questions, you are signaling to the interviewer that you have taken the time to research the company and understand the position. This shows that you are not just looking for any job, but that you are specifically interested in this opportunity. Furthermore, asking insightful questions can help you stand out from other candidates. Many job seekers make the mistake of only focusing on answering the interviewer's questions, rather than engaging in a two-way conversation. By asking questions, you are showing that you are actively participating in the dialogue and are eager to learn more about the company and the role. Moreover, asking insightful questions can also help you gain a better understanding of the company culture and expectations. This can give you valuable information to determine if the company is the right fit for you. It also shows the interviewer that you are thinking ahead and considering how you would fit into the organization. In addition, asking questions can help you clarify any uncertainties you may have about the role or the company. This can demonstrate to the interviewer that you are detail-oriented and proactive in seeking clarification. It also shows that you are not afraid to ask for help or guidance when needed, which can be an attractive quality to potential employers.
  1. Asking insightful questions during an interview is a crucial step in demonstrating your interest in the role. It shows that you are prepared, engaged, and genuinely interested in the opportunity. So remember, don't be afraid to ask questions - it can truly make a difference in how you are perceived during the interview process.
